
mobile standards
Mobile standards are technical rules and protocols that enable devices from different manufacturers to communicate reliably over cellular networks. They ensure that phones can connect to networks, send messages, make calls, and access the internet seamlessly. Examples include LTE, 3G, 5G, and earlier standards, each providing different speeds and capabilities. These standards promote compatibility, improve performance, and support the development of new services, allowing a wide variety of devices to work together efficiently within the global mobile ecosystem.
